Emmaline Whittington

Emmaline Whittington, 79, of Van Wert, died at 12:17 p.m. Friday, May 24, 2013, at the Van Wert Area Inpatient Hospice Center.

She was born June 14, 1933, in Lafe, Ark., and daughter of the late Barnie T. and Eula May (O’Guin) Gribble. On May 28, 1954, she married Leon Whittington, who survives in Van Wert.

Other survivors include a son, Allen (Theresa) Whittington of Van Wert; one daughter, Angela Jaylene (Bruce) Albee of Middle Point; four brothers, Talma (Marilyn) Gribble, Melvin (Barb) Gribble, Alvin (Gail) Gribble and Lee (Lolita) Gribble, all of Grover Hill; a sister, Thelma (Ishmael) Shelton of Oakwood; four grandchildren; one stepgrandchild; seven great-grandchildren; and two stepgreat-grandchildren.

Two brothers, Denzil and Verlin Gribble; and three sisters, Eladis A. Hinchcliff, Leona Busbey and Sliva Deckard, also preceded her in death.

Funeral services will be conducted at 2 p.m. Monday, May 27, at Cowan & Son Funeral Home in Van Wert, with Pastor Jim Burns officiating. Burial will be in Middle Creek Cemetery in Grover Hill.

Calling hours are from 10 a.m. until the time of services Monday at the funeral home.
